Merseyside Police is appealing for the public’s help in tracing a missing teenage girl from Knowsley who was last seen on Tuesday.

Courtney Walker, who is 15-years-old and originally from Stockbridge Village but currently lives in Runcorn, Cheshire was last seen in Greenway Road on January 27.

Courtney is described as white, approximately 4 ft. 10 inches tall of slim build, with hazel eyes, a pale complexion and long brown hair which she has been known to dye red. She was last seen wearing dark grey leggings, a grey top, a long black coat and black and pink trainers.

She is known to frequent the Chatsworth Park and Lodge Lane areas of Toxteth; the McDonalds restaurant in Liverpool city centre; Wavertree in south Liverpool and Runcorn in Halton, Cheshire.

Courtney has gone missing before but is regarded as vulnerable due to her young age.

Her family and the police are becoming increasingly concerned about her whereabouts and would urge anyone who has seen her recently or knows where she is to contact Merseyside Police on 0151 777 5312 or the Missing People Charity on 116 000.
